Hilfecenter

Alles, was Sie über SSH Config Manager wissen müssen

🔍

Keine Artikel gefunden. Versuchen Sie andere Suchbegriffe oder kontaktieren Sie den Support.

Installation

Installation unter macOS

SSH Config Manager wird als signierter, aber noch nicht notarisierter DMG ausgeliefert. Beim ersten Start fragt macOS Gatekeeper nach einer Bestätigung.

  1. Laden Sie SSHConfigManager.dmg herunter und öffnen Sie die Datei.
  2. Ziehen Sie SSH Config Manager in Ihren Programme-Ordner.
  3. Klicken Sie mit der rechten Maustaste auf die App in /Programme und wählen Sie Öffnen. macOS zeigt einen Warnhinweis — klicken Sie im Dialog auf Öffnen.
  4. Das ist nur einmal nötig. Jeder weitere Start funktioniert normal.

Erfordert macOS 13 (Ventura) oder neuer auf Apple Silicon oder Intel.

Config bearbeiten

SSH Config Manager liest und schreibt ~/.ssh/config. Klicken Sie in der Config-Seitenleiste auf + Host, um einen neuen Eintrag anzulegen. Jedes Feld (Host, HostName, User, Port usw.) hat einen Picker mit gültigen Werten und Hilfetexten.

Änderungen werden sofort auf die Festplatte geschrieben. Ihre bestehende Config bleibt erhalten — Kommentare, Formatierung und nicht standardmäßige Optionen werden bewahrt.

Der Editor zeigt über 40 Optionen gruppiert nach Zweck (Verbindung, Authentifizierung, Forwarding, Sicherheit, Erweitert). Weniger übliche Einstellungen wie ProxyJump, LocalForward, Match und CertificateFile werden ebenso mit Picker-UI unterstützt.

SSH-Schlüssel

Wechseln Sie in den Bereich SSH-Schlüssel und klicken Sie auf + Schlüssel. Wählen Sie den Algorithmus (ED25519 empfohlen), geben Sie einen Dateinamen ein und optional eine Passphrase. Öffentliche und private Dateien werden mit den korrekten 600/644-Berechtigungen nach ~/.ssh/ geschrieben.

Klicken Sie in der Liste auf einen Schlüssel — der Public-Key-Block erscheint mit einer Kopieren-Schaltfläche. Fügen Sie ihn in die ~/.ssh/authorized_keys auf Ihrem Server oder in eine GitHub-/GitLab-/Gitea-Schlüsselseite ein.

Known Hosts

Wenn der Host-Key eines Servers sich ändert (Neuinstallation, Key-Rotation), verweigert SSH die Verbindung. Öffnen Sie Known Hosts, suchen Sie nach Hostname oder IP und klicken Sie auf Entfernen. Gehashte Einträge werden transparent behandelt — Sie müssen den tatsächlichen Hostnamen nicht kennen.

Lokale Skripte

Der Bereich Skripte verwaltet ausführbare Dateien in /usr/local/bin/. Erstellen Sie ein neues Skript, fügen Sie Ihren Shell-Code ein und speichern Sie. Die App chmodd das Skript automatisch auf 755 und macht es auf Ihrem $PATH verfügbar.

Das Schreiben nach /usr/local/bin/ erfordert Administratorrechte. SSH Config Manager fragt zuerst per Touch ID an, fällt dann auf Ihr Admin-Passwort zurück, wenn Touch ID nicht verfügbar ist.

Fehlerbehebung

Siehe Installation oben — Sie müssen beim ersten Mal mit Rechtsklick Öffnen wählen.

Bestätigen Sie beim Speichern eines Skripts die Touch-ID- oder Passwort-Aufforderung. Wenn die Aufforderung abgebrochen wird, wird der Schreibvorgang stillschweigend beendet. Ist Touch ID auf Ihrem Mac nicht eingerichtet, fällt SSH Config Manager auf osascript mit Admin-Passwort-Dialog zurück.

Schreiben Sie an info@toz.red und geben Sie Ihre macOS-Version, die App-Version und eine Beschreibung des Problems an.